    Love it when a plan doesn't come together

    "Dad, can you come and watch me play footy? I got picked to play in a carnival for school"
    "Sure, what day is it?"
    "Thursday"

    So after arranging with my boss to have Thursday off I was chatting with the missus Wednesday night and asked what time I have to have the young fella at the footy. "8:30am, but it's not till next week"

    Well, I already had the day off so straight to the shed and prep the tinny. I had heard reports of jewwys and threadys being caught in the passage so rigged up to chase some. Up at 3;30am launched at 4am and was casting by 4:15am. Nice still morning with only a light breeze. Tide was on the run out with low expected around 7am. There was a fair bit of surface action with what I thought to be mullet but also turned out to be tarpon too I think. Not a lot of action in the first hour but just as the sun light winked on the horizon I had a hit on my 100mm squidgy. In comes a 47cm soapie. Nice bit of fun on the 6lb braid!

    Fished the same spot for a couple of small bream but no more jewwys so I headed south for a flatty or two. Cruised down to a spot I have been eyeing off and thought I would give it a shot. There was no boat traffic on the water at all and I felt really confident I would get a fish in this spot. I wasn't disappointed, 1st cast a nice flatty comes boatside! Yessss!

    Cruised around the general area until the battery ran out for the iPilot Ended up with 3 nice flattys for the table. Put a few back too.
    On the way home I pulled up at the jew hole and scored a couple more bream and also hooked up to a good sized tarpon that put on a fantastic aerial display before snapping me off at the boat! Heap of fun. The rain started around 10am so I cruise up towards Bells, threw a line it at the mouth, in comes another flatty. Let him go, I had enough for now.
